.section-heading{text-align:center;color:#14202e;font-size:20px;font-style:normal;font-weight:400;line-height:normal;letter-spacing:.4px;text-transform:uppercase}.section-heading.left{text-align:left}.section-heading.right{text-align:right}.circle_svg{margin-right:20px}.circle_svg svg{max-width:14px;width:14px;height:14px;margin-bottom:2px}.shop-by-choice{text-align:center}.tabs-headings{display:flex;justify-content:flex-start;list-style:none;border-top:1px solid #cfcfcf;background:linear-gradient(to bottom,#d3d9df 0% 80%,#0a2a47 80% 100%);gap:12px;overflow-x:auto;margin-bottom:20px;margin-left:0;padding:7px 0 7px 15px}.tabs-headings::-webkit-scrollbar{display:none}.tabs-headings{-ms-overflow-style:none;scrollbar-width:none}.tab-heading{cursor:pointer;display:flex;padding:0 10px;justify-content:center;align-items:center;gap:8px;white-space:nowrap;margin-bottom:0}.tab-heading.active{background:#fff;color:#0a2a47;border-radius:10px 10px 0 0}.tab-heading.active .tab-title{color:#14202e;font-size:20px;font-style:normal;font-weight:900;line-height:normal;letter-spacing:.4px}.tab-heading.active .tab-icon{filter:brightness(0) saturate(100%) invert(27%) sepia(97%) saturate(1200%) hue-rotate(180deg) brightness(102%) contrast(102%)}.circle-divider{display:flex;align-items:center}.circle-icon{width:8px;height:8px;max-width:8px}.tab-icon{margin-top:5px;width:31px;height:28px;transition:transform .3s ease}.tab-title{color:#14202e;font-size:20px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:.4px}.tabs-content .tab_content.active{display:block}.tab-images{display:grid;grid-template-columns:repeat(2,1fr);gap:12px}.tab-image{display:block;width:100%;height:100%;border-radius:4px}.tab-image img{width:100%;height:100%;max-width:unset;object-fit:cover;border-radius:4px}.treo-collection-lists .collection-filter{display:none}.tab-heading.active .products-count{font-weight:600;color:#4572b5}.treo-collection-lists .collection-grid{display:flex;flex-wrap:wrap}.treo-collection-lists .grid-item{flex:0 0 50%}.treo-collection-lists .collection-offer-banner{margin:6px 0 16px}.treo-collection-lists .collection-offer-banner img{width:100%;height:auto;max-width:unset;border-radius:4px}@media screen and (max-width: 768px){.tab-heading{padding:5px 8px 0;gap:15px;font-size:14px;flex-direction:column}.tabs-headings{display:flex;justify-content:flex-start;list-style:none;border-top:1px solid #cfcfcf;background:linear-gradient(to bottom,#d3d9df 0% 77%,#0a2a47 65% 100%);gap:12px;overflow-x:auto;margin-bottom:20px;margin-left:0;padding:7px 0 0 15px}.tab-heading.active .tab-title{color:#14202e;text-align:center;font-size:10px;font-style:normal;font-weight:800;line-height:normal;letter-spacing:.2px}.tab-title{padding:3px 0;color:#fff;font-size:10px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:.2px}}@media screen and (min-width: 750px){.tabs-headings{justify-content:center;padding:5px 60px 0;gap:12px}.tab-heading.active{padding:14px 20px}.section-heading:before{width:16px;height:16px}.tab-images{grid-template-columns:repeat(3,1fr)}.treo-collection-lists .collection-offer-banner{margin:30px 0 40px}.treo-collection-lists .grid-item{flex:0 0 25%}}@media screen and (min-width: 990px){.tabs-headings{gap:calc(12px + (38 - 12) * (100vw - 1000px) / (1440 - 990))}}.tab-image-wrapper{overflow:hidden;position:relative;flex:1 1 calc(33.333% - 16px);box-sizing:border-box}.tab-image-link{display:block}.tab-image{width:100%;height:auto;display:block;transition:transform .3s ease;will-change:transform}.tab-image-wrapper:hover .tab-image{transform:scale(1.1);z-index:2}.tab-image-button{position:absolute;padding:10px 20px;color:#fff;text-decoration:none;border-radius:6px;font-weight:600;display:inline-flex;align-items:center;gap:6px;transition:background .3s ease;top:50%;left:50%;transform:translate(-50%,-50%);background-color:#1f3a58}.tab-image-button:hover .arrow-icon{transform:translate(4px)}.arrow-icon{width:36px;height:28px;transition:transform .3s ease;position:relative;top:2px}@media (max-width: 749px){.arrow-icon{width:16px;height:16px;transition:transform .3s ease}.tab-image-button{position:absolute;bottom:53px;left:50%;transform:translate(-50%);padding:7px 6px;color:#fff;text-decoration:none;border-radius:4px;font-weight:600;display:inline-flex;align-items:center;gap:0px;transition:background .3s ease;font-size:xx-small;white-space:nowrap}}.tabs-headings{padding:16px 15px 0}.tabs-wrapper .tabs-headings{gap:24px}.tabs-wrapper .tabs-headings li.active{padding:8px 12px 2px 13px;border-radius:25px 25px 0 0}.tabs-wrapper .tabs-headings li:not(.active){padding:8px 7px 2px}.tab-image-button{display:flex;padding:5px 10px;align-items:center;gap:9px;font-size:14px;font-weight:400;line-height:normal;letter-spacing:.28px}@media screen and (min-width: 750px){.tabs-headings{padding:12px 0 0}.tabs-wrapper .tabs-headings{gap:54px;background:linear-gradient(to bottom,#d3d9df 0% 88%,#0a2a47 80% 100%)}.tabs-wrapper .tabs-headings li.active{padding:19px 27px 24px;border-radius:25px 25px 0 0;gap:14px}.tabs-wrapper .tabs-headings li:not(.active){padding:19px 0 24px}.tabs-wrapper .tabs-headings .tab-icon{margin-top:0;width:34px;height:34px}.tabs-wrapper .tabs-headings .tab-icon img{object-fit:contain;width:100%;height:100%}.tab-image-button{font-size:16px;font-weight:400;line-height:normal;letter-spacing:.32px}.tab-image-button .arrow-icon{width:16px;height:16px}}
/*# sourceMappingURL=/cdn/shop/t/33/assets/shop-by-choice.css.map */
